Methods: Open (incision on the columella, for complex cases) and
Closed (all incisions are internal, no visible scars).
Anesthesia: Almost always general anesthesia. The surgery lasts
1–3 hours.
Recovery: A splint (cast) is worn for
7–10 days. Major bruising usually subsides within 2 weeks.
Results: Initial results are visible after a month; final results appear only after
6–12 months, once internal swelling has fully resolved.
Complexity: This is the most unpredictable plastic surgery, as tissues can scar differently for each individual.
- Important: The priority is not just an "aesthetic nose," but ensuring that breathing remains clear and healthy.
